Due to JC's absence (despite his inability to overcome his forum addiction) in the Mortal Moments offices, I've been tasked with muddling through things to continue to deliver content to the starving masses. As such, there will be no fun or merriment of any kind. Maybe. I don't really know, but as you saw last night (viewtopic.php?f=2&t=14322), we will still be making spot fixes based on user feedback and our own playtesting. Besides that, though, we do have new features we intend to release into Popham (and probably later into Providence and subsequent expeditions). This list is subject to change but gives you guys the broad strokes of our goals while experiencing this downtime development lull.

Each step involves a monthly goal, so July's goal will be porting animals to providence, August will be a darkness mob, etc, etc. Of course, if the server ends before a goal is realized, it may still happen. Maybe.

ShadowTani wrote:Animals get ported to providence already next month? I thought that would happen on Popham Apocalypse? Or will the boxed animals get ported once per month? o.O


The technology for it needs to be completed. We want you to be able to take back the exact animals that you "bank" on Popham for saving. That kind of transfer is a big deal though and will need to be finished to make it possible. However, since that's the whole point of expeditions, it's being prioritized lest someone does manage to end the server with remarkable speed.
